Creamy Chicken Soup (Print Version)

# Ingredients:

→ Main Components

01 - 1 package (5 oz) baby spinach, chopped roughly
02 - 20 oz pack of cheese-filled tortellini from the fridge
03 - 2 1/2 pounds chicken breasts, bone-in and skin-on

→ Aromatics and Tomatoes

04 - 6 oz can of thick tomato paste
05 - 2 teaspoons garlic, minced (about 2 cloves)
06 - A large yellow onion, chopped (about 1 1/2 cups)
07 - 2/3 cup chopped sun-dried tomatoes packed in oil, plus a tablespoon of the oil

→ Dairy and Cheese

08 - 1 1/2 cups shredded Parmesan cheese (4 1/2 ounces)
09 - 1 cup of rich heavy cream
10 - 1 1/2 cups shredded Havarti cheese (6 ounces)

→ Liquids and Seasonings

11 - 1 tablespoon freshly squeezed lemon juice
12 - 8 cups of chicken stock or broth
13 - 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
14 - 2 teaspoons smoked paprika
15 - 2 teaspoons of kosher salt, divided
16 - 2 teaspoons Italian seasoning blend

# Instructions:

01 - Over medium-high heat, warm the oil from the sun-dried tomatoes in a big pan. Sprinkle salt (1/2 tsp.) and pepper on the chicken. Cook each side for three minutes to brown them, then move the pieces to the slow cooker.
02 - Use the same pan to cook up the onion until golden, about five minutes. Toss in the garlic and let it cook for two more minutes. Add the tomato paste, stirring it around for 2-3 minutes until it smells amazing.
03 - Pour 1 cup of broth into the pan, scraping up all that nice brown stuff on the bottom. Dump this into the slow cooker along with the rest of the broth, salt, and seasonings.
04 - Cover the slow cooker and leave it to do the work. Cook on LOW for 5-6 hours, or on HIGH for 3-4 hours, until the chicken is cooked through. Take the chicken out, let it cool just a bit, then pull it apart, tossing the bones and skin.
05 - Toss the tortellini, spinach, and sun-dried tomatoes into the slow cooker. If it’s not already on HIGH, switch it over. Cook for about 10 minutes until the pasta is soft. Add the lemon juice.
06 - Pour the cream in and slowly mix in the cheeses until they melt completely. Stir the shredded chicken back into the slow cooker, then taste and tweak the seasoning if needed.

# Notes:

01 - If your chicken doesn’t move when you try flipping it, let it cook for 1-2 more minutes before trying again.
02 - To avoid curdling, wait for the tortellini to be fully cooked before you add the cream and cheese.
